Are you a Law Librarian...who is a member of the British & Irish Association of Law Librarians (BIALL)...and would like to become involved with the work of BIALL...then I'd love to hear from you!
BIALL relies on its members to volunteer for committees that work on projects like the BIALL Website, The Conference, BIALL Salary Surveys and much much more.
But why would you want to become involved in the work of a committee? Well for one thing committee work is a great way to network with your peers and colleagues (there is normally a social element to any work on a committee) committees also offer the opportunity for you to benchmark the work you're doing with other Law Librarians and for you to share concerns and any issues you may have. Committee work also looks great when it comes to professsional development, just look at me here! and really aren't that onerous, three or maybe four meetings a year at most.
